qloud.my domain details

already registered

rank: 263264

best rank: 76870

known ips: 58.84.42.219 (1) 104.18.38.90 (77) 104.18.39.90 (91) 172.67.143.201 (105) 104.21.39.78 (106) 188.114.97.3 (880930) 188.114.96.3 (889546)